> Consider the ramifications of populating the flow.tar (cluster) with an existing flow.xml.gz if no existing flow.tar is found.
> This would only be appropriate if no flow.tar or any of its counterparts (such as flow.tar.stale or flow.tar.unknown) exists.
> This could be helpful for folks wanting to migrate from a single node configuration to a cluster configuration.
